DuPont Innovations Enhance Sustainable Construction for Beijing Landmark in Time for the Olympics
DuPont™ Tyvek® Products Enhance Energy Efficiency of Beichen National Convention Center
BEIJING, China and WILMINGTON, Del., August 27, 2007 -- In preparation for the athletes competing in Beijing next year, DuPont innovations play a critical role in the sustainable construction of the Beichen National Convention Center, which will be the hub of the international broadcast media covering the athletic competition in 2008.
DuPont innovations will help protect the building envelope and improve indoor comfort, as well as save significantly on the building’s energy-costs by reducing heat transfer. DuPont™ Tyvek® ThermaWrap™ and Tyvek® SD2 Vapor Control Layer offer superior strength and durability, a further benefit in the drive toward reducing the carbon footprint of buildings.

In a major and prestigious construction project, the materials will work together with an interlayer of glasswool insulation to create a thermal and moisture control solution. Designed by RMJM Architects and engineered by Ove Arup, the Convention Center is a 270,000 square meter steel structure with a roofing area exceeding 50,000 square meters. In addition to serving as the main press center during the athletic competition in 2008, the building will also serve as the stadium for the Fencing and Modern Pentathlon competitions.
The roof will be constructed of two layers of profiled steel, between which the membranes and insulation will create an air-tight, water-tight, yet vapor-permeable seal to protect the building envelope and improve interior comfort – a key function for a building that will house thousands of people and lots of electronic equipment.
DuPont™ Tyvek® ThermaWrap™ is a metalized breather membrane which combines high reflectivity and low emissivity surfaces to reduce radiant heat transfer with superior moisture diffusion capacity. The membrane also blocks radiant heat gains in the summer, which will be a significant benefit considering the timing of the games. DuPont™ Tyvek® SD2, is an ultra-strong vapor control layer and air-leakage barrier.

DuPont – one of the first companies to publicly establish environmental goals 16 years ago – has broadened its sustainability commitments beyond internal footprint reduction to include market-driven targets for both revenue and research and development investment like Tyvek®. The goals are tied directly to business growth, specifically to the development of safer and environmentally improved new products for key global markets, including products that help increase energy efficiency, such as Tyvek®.
